The view from this property cannot be overstated, It is right on the Intercostal with a daily parade of all size boats passing. It is also directly across from a nature reserve so you are not looking into someone's backyard. Lots of wild life to see. It is a short ride (or walk) over the Intercoastal to Sullivan Park where you can get a free boat ride over to the reserve which has walking trails. We had our grandchildren over for a few nights and they loved the reserve as well as Sullivan Park which has a "fountain pool" and playground for kids. They also enjoyed fishing off the patio. The house is only a short 8 minute walk to the beach and "downtown" Deerfield Beach where everything is happening. We had a slight problem with the AC but Al took care of it immediately. My family and I loved the place, it was neat and comfortable. The patio was definitely one of our favorite feature, we could just sit and watch the boat show on the intracoastal. Our 2 kids (9 and 10) loved chasing around lizards and being able to observe so close the Iguanas coming to get a sun bath a few feet away from us. On the other side of the intracoastal is Deerfield Island park, a nature preserve and education center, so there is a lot of wildlife to watch. The apartment is very well oriented and it was especially nice to be able to sit inside the living room or lay in the bed and have the same nice view of the water and the island.
It is walking distance from a beach access and also from shops and restaurants. The owner is very nice and accommodating which made the stay even better. I would reserve it again in a heartbeat!
